Transaction 21fb3762905ecc9cb40b47250dd5de19a4d7a7c846b8c0ab4bdbf838294c1e2f

2 Input
2 Outputs
  • 21fb3762905ecc9cb40b47250dd5de19a4d7a7c846b8c0ab4bdbf838294c1e2f:0
  • value  235242
    address  133tPw3brkQK1n2WXTDXUHEtMk63DhLpRx
  • 21fb3762905ecc9cb40b47250dd5de19a4d7a7c846b8c0ab4bdbf838294c1e2f:1
  • value  745793
    address  3HPYkhTAk28DoZManbG9U5psqLAgjn8pkj